A permanent white spot is a possible adverse effects of this treatment. What frequently distinguishes these developments from various other sores is a waxy, pasted-on-the-skin look. A SK can resemble a dab of warm, brown candle wax on the skin. Usually beginning as small, harsh bumps, SKs tend to ultimately thicken and create a warty surface area. Many are brownish, but these growths vary in color from light tan to black. Some SKs determine a portion of an inch; others are larger than a half-dollar.
